We've got a listener Q&A episode of Renegade Radio this week where we discuss training volume, frequency, intensity, recovery, my biggest mistakes and much more.
Then I address the importance of "packaging and presentation," and how to show up every day as a superstar worthy of getting paid a million dollars an hour.
Finally, I share some deep thoughts and life lessons on what we should all strive to avoid.
Questions answered include:
How many sets should you do per muscle group, per week?
The difference between training for newbies and advanced lifters.
How to eat for size without wrecking your gut.
Optimal training frequency.
One change females can make to their workouts.
How to build muscle and burn fat at the same time.
The key to making gains that no one talks enough about.
How to present yourself like a rock star.
Do clothes make the man?
Tips on making meditation easier and more effective.
What to do when one side is much weaker than the other.
My biggest training mistake ever.
Who is on my WWE Mount Rushmore?
How often do I go to the beach?
Programming sled pushes into your workouts.
What scares me most?
